LIFETIME PRODUCTIVE TRAITS OF HOLSTEIN FRIESIAN CATTLE RAISED IN EGYPT

SAFAA SALAH SANAD IBRAHIM;

Abstract


A study on age at first calving , longevity traits and lifetime milk production traits was carried out in a commercial Holstein Friesian herd raised in El-Salhia, Esmaillia Governorate . That herd belongs to the General Cooparative for Developing the Animal Weath and
Products.

Longevity traits were represented by age at last calving , length of productive life , length of herd life and number of lactations completed by the cow before its disposal . Lifetime milk production traits studied were lifetime 305-day milk yield , lifetime total milk yield , lifetime days in milk , milk yield per day of lifetime days in milk , milk yield per day of productive life and milk yield per day of herd life.
Data dealt with were taken on 5662 normal lactations given by

I 029 cows sired by 139 bulls during nine consecutive years ( 1984 -

1992 ) . These data were analyzed using the least-squares maximum likelihood computer program of Harvey ( 1990).
